Franklin R. Schneier is a scholar working on Experimental and Cognitive Psychology, Clinical Psychology and Psychiatry and Mental health. According to data from OpenAlex, Franklin R. Schneier has authored 10 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Experimental and Cognitive Psychology, 6 papers in Clinical Psychology and 5 papers in Psychiatry and Mental health. Recurrent topics in Franklin R. Schneier’s work include Anxiety, Depression, Psychometrics, Treatment, Cognitive Processes (8 papers), Child and Adolescent Psychosocial and Emotional Development (4 papers) and Mental Health Research Topics (2 papers). Franklin R. Schneier is often cited by papers focused on Anxiety, Depression, Psychometrics, Treatment, Cognitive Processes (8 papers), Child and Adolescent Psychosocial and Emotional Development (4 papers) and Mental Health Research Topics (2 papers). Franklin R. Schneier collaborates with scholars based in United States. Franklin R. Schneier's co-authors include Michael R. Liebowitz, Randall D. Marshall, Raphael Campeas, Brian A. Fallon and Shu‐Hsing Lin and has published in prestigious journals such as American Journal of Psychiatry, Movement Disorders and The Journal of Clinical Psychiatry.
